Blackstone Smashed Cinnamon Rolls

Blackstone Smashed Cinnamon Rolls

No more waiting for 20 minutes for Cinnamon Rolls to bake in the oven! Smashed Cinnamon Rolls on the Blackstone are done in less than 5 minutes! These Cinnamon Rolls are fluffy with a little crunch and drenched in icing!

Ingredients
  

  • 1 can Grands Cinnamon Rolls

Instructions
 

  • Heat griddle on medium – keep the flame low!
  • Sprinkle light coat of oil across griddle
  • You can also use butter or bacon grease for more flavor
  • Open cinnamon roll tube and lay down canned cinnamon rolls across preheated griddle leaving plenty of space between them for pressing
    1 can Grands Cinnamon Rolls
  • Using a heavy spatula or burger press, press cinnamon rolls flat on the first side.
  • Best to lay a sheet of parchment paper on each roll before pressing so they don’t stick. If you don’t have that – just use another griddle spatula to slip off.
  • Heat for 1-2 minutes and flip when golden brown. WATCH CLOSELY as they cook super fast! Cooking times will vary slightly based on the thickness of the cinnamon roll.
  • Heat for 1-2 minutes more until that side is golden brown perfection.
  • Remove cinnamon rolls and drizzle with icing
